How-to Guide

Entry: Share → Link Permissions

  1. Open the document and click Share in the upper-right corner.
  2. Turn on View/Edit with others.
  3. Click Link Permissions.
  4. In the Link Permissions panel, choose who can open the link, such as everyone or specific people.
  5. Set the permission level to Edit, View and Comment, or View.

Success Criteria

  • Interface result: the sharing panel shows the current link permission settings.
  • Next action available: you can continue copying the link or return to the document.
  • No unwanted effect: the access rules can be updated without creating a new link.

Tips While Using

  • Common mistake: if View/Edit with others is not turned on first, the full link permission options may not appear.
  • Environment note: this feature requires an internet connection and document collaboration support.

Entry: Share → Advanced Settings → Link Expiration

  1. In the sharing page, click Advanced Settings.
  2. Find Link Expiration.
  3. Select Permanent, 7 days, or 30 days.
  4. Return to the sharing page and continue sending or copying the link.

Success Criteria

  • Interface result: Advanced Settings shows the selected link duration.
  • Next action available: you can continue sharing the current link directly.
  • No unwanted effect: the existing link follows the updated expiration rule.

Tips While Using

  • Common mistake: after changing the expiration setting, users may overlook the time limit before sending the link.
  • Environment note: link expiration depends on online sharing features and cannot be configured offline.
